## Step 4: Migrate the watchdog

The old Lanternbox kiosks ran a shell-script watchdog that just killed and relaunched the app every time the heartbeat file went stale. The new Brightstall watchdog is a proper daemon: it tracks restart counts, backs off on crash loops, and reports upstream. Heads up for whoever maintains this later — the daemon refuses to start if the legacy script is still installed, so remove that first. Once it's gone, install the daemon and seed its config with the values below.

settings of kageg-yawig:
[casix]
host = casix.tolvaqlabs.corp
user = casix_svc
database = casix_prod

## Authentication

Heads up: the nightly reindex job (`reindex_nightly.py`) talks to the Lanternfish search cluster, and that cluster won't accept anonymous writes anymore — we locked it down last sprint. The job now authenticates as the `reindex-runner` service identity against Corvid Gateway, and the token is injected via the `LF_INDEX_TOKEN` env var in the scheduler config. Nothing clever going on, just a bearer header on every batch request. For review purposes, the staging credential currently in use is listed below.

service key, kadug-kadup: kto15_rN23XLAYImmZgrJ

# Service Accounts — Packwire Telemetry

The Packwire compressor batches telemetry payloads and gzips them before shipping to the internal Lanternfold collector. It runs under the `svc-packwire-compress` account, which has write-only access to the collector intake.

Maintainers: rotation is quarterly; compression settings live in the deploy manifest, not here.

Authenticate the compressor against Lanternfold with the key below.

API key for yahig-tadup: kto7_ubizbYm

### Siftgate bloom filter — quick facts

Before any lookup hits Vaultkeep, it passes through Siftgate, our bloom filter layer. It answers "definitely not here" fast, which is why most missing-key complaints resolve in milliseconds. False positives are expected and harmless — they just fall through to the store. If customers report stale misses after a bulk import, the filter probably needs a rebuild; that's a one-command job, but ping the Harrowvale rota first. For reference, the filter runs with the following configuration values:

config for taguf-tagaf:
[istix]
port = 9300
team = aldix
host = istix.qorvelsoft.example
region = upper-2
access_code = ac_bda5cc
timeout_ms = 5000